As important as sewer lines are to the overall functionality of your house, unfortunately, they’re not always completely immune to undergoing damage. When this is the case, sewer repair becomes urgent. For many decades, the only option to repair the sewer lines was to traditionally dig for the pipes to inspect where the area of the damage was. This scenario naturally caused a big mess and was very time- and effort-consuming. Nowadays, there’s also the option of trenchless sewer repair. In order to understand the exact location of the damage, this method simply consists of excavating a large area and removing the pipes to repair all the damaged areas.
Trenchless sewer repair in Salado, TX is the latest technological advancement that allows repairs without serious digging like traditional methods. There are mainly two methods that allow this to happen—pipe lining and pipe bursting. Both are carried out through narrow openings as opposed to open trenches.
The best option for your sewer repair journey is entirely dependent on many factors, such as the layout of your property, the severity of the damage, and your budget. If you don’t mind some excavation in your backyard and the situation is really suitable for it, you can consider the traditional approach.
